**09:47** — The Scanbridge integration at the Fennmore warehouse began rejecting valid barcodes after the overnight deploy. Root cause was a checksum routine in the new parser that mishandled leading zeros. We rolled back within twenty minutes and queued scans replayed cleanly. Maintainers should note that the parser change was never flagged in review because the test fixtures lacked zero-padded samples. The rollback target build is recorded below.

build token for kahif-kajof: htk4_c609

Subject: Handover — Quillstream release duties

Hi, and welcome aboard. You're inheriting releases for Quillstream, our message queue. The big ongoing item is the log compaction work: compaction now runs per-partition, and any release touching the compactor needs the retention soak test (48 hours on the Harlow staging ring) before promotion. Keep an eye on segment-merge latency during canary — it's the first thing to regress. Releases must be signed before the deployer will accept them. The signing key is:

release key, bahip-badup: bky6_beTSu1

### Runbook: ReceiptRelay mailer stuck

Symptoms: donation receipts queueing, no sends, queue depth alert fires.

First: check the SMTP relay health endpoint. If healthy, the mailer worker is probably wedged on a malformed template — restart the worker pool, not the whole service. If unhealthy, fail over to the secondary relay and page the infra rotation. Do not replay the dead-letter queue until dedupe is confirmed on, or donors get duplicate receipts. Verify the service is running with the following configuration values.

config for kajeg-bafop:
[julael]
host = julael.plorvadata.corp
user = julael_svc
database = julael_prod